I have a 1980 Gmc C3500.

After a weekend of jump starting, and some trail and error I put in a new battery. In doing so my fuel gauge now reads past Full in the 3 o’clock position. The fuel selector switch does not change the position of the needle on either side tank. Could I have blown the fuse fuel selector fuse. Or is it a ground issue?
